Understanding the Dogecoin to PKR Exchange Rate

The Dogecoin to PKR rate is not a single fixed number. It floats based on the global DOGE/USD price, then gets adjusted by the local exchange or P2P desk offering the conversion. Because the Pakistani Rupee itself moves against the dollar, you will see slightly different rates on every platform you check.

As a general rule of thumb, multiply the current DOGE price in USD by the open market USD/PKR rate, then factor in the platform's spread and any withdrawal fees. Top global exchanges tend to offer tighter spreads, while local P2P sellers may quote a premium for the convenience of direct bank transfers or JazzCash settlements.

Key factors that move the DOGE PKR rate

  • Global DOGE price action: Bitcoin's moves, Elon Musk tweets, and broader market sentiment ripple into every DOGE chart.
  • USD/PKR parity: A weaker rupee makes the same amount of DOGE worth more PKR, even if DOGE itself is flat.
  • Platform liquidity: Bigger exchanges offer better rates; small P2P sellers may charge more.
  • Network congestion: Busy blockchain days can slow withdrawals and push users toward instant off-ramps that cost extra.

How to Convert Dogecoin to PKR Step by Step

Converting your DOGE into spendable rupees is a straightforward process once you have the right setup. Most Pakistani users follow one of two paths: cashing out through a global exchange to a local bank, or using a P2P marketplace to sell directly to a buyer.

Method 1: Sell on a global exchange

  1. Sign up on a major exchange that supports DOGE and PKR withdrawals or P2P trading.
  2. Transfer your Dogecoin from your personal wallet to the exchange's DOGE deposit address.
  3. Sell DOGE for USDT, then convert USDT into PKR via the P2P marketplace.
  4. Withdraw rupees to your bank account, JazzCash, or EasyPaisa wallet.

Method 2: Use a P2P trading desk

  1. Open a P2P platform that serves Pakistani buyers and sellers.
  2. List your DOGE at a competitive PKR price.
  3. Wait for a buyer to lock the trade and send payment confirmation.
  4. Release DOGE from escrow once the rupees hit your account.

Both routes work, but P2P usually pays out faster and accepts a wider range of local payment methods. The trade-off is that you must vet your trading partner, stick to platform escrow, and never release coins before your bank confirms the deposit.
